Help them stay active

As we age, it’s essential to stay active and maintain our health and wellness. Unfortunately, many elderly people find themselves becoming more sedentary as they age, leading to a decline in their overall health. There are several reasons for this, including retirement, declining mobility, and chronic health conditions. However, there are also some ways to help promote health and wellness in the elderly.

One way is to encourage them to stay active. Regular physical activity has improved mental health, reduced the risk of chronic diseases such as heart disease and stroke, and improved balance and flexibility. Additionally, physical activity can help to reduce feelings of isolation and loneliness. There are many ways to help the elderly stay active, such as joining an exercise class or walking with a friend or family member.

Help them stay socially active.

As people age, they must stay socially active. There are many benefits to social activities, including reducing stress, improving brain function, and increasing life satisfaction. There are some ways to promote social activity among the elderly. One is to encourage them to participate in community events. This could include attending musical performances, going on group outings, or participating in religious or cultural activities.

You can also help them stay socially active by registering them in an independent living facility. These facilities offer several amenities and activities, such as fitness classes, social events, and outings, allowing them to meet new people.

Encourage them to eat healthily.

A healthy diet is vital at any age, but it becomes even more essential as we get older. Unfortunately, many seniors make poor food choices that can lead to weight gain, malnutrition, and other health problems. Fortunately, there are steps that caregivers can take to encourage their elderly loved ones to eat more healthfully.

One of the most important things is to provide them with healthy options that are easy to prepare and appealing to the palate. Another critical step is to avoid penalizing them for poor food choices; instead, try to focus on the positive benefits of making healthier choices. With a little effort, it is possible to promote better health and wellness in the elderly through proper nutrition.

Make sure they see their doctor regularly.

medical checkup of a senior patientIt becomes increasingly important to pay attention to our health and wellness as we age. That means making sure we see our doctor regularly for many of us. However, that can be easier said than done, especially if we have trouble getting around or don’t have insurance. However, there are many programs and services available to help seniors get the care they need. Medicaid and Medicare are two government-sponsored programs that provide health coverage for seniors. There are also some private insurance plans that offer seniors discounts. In addition, many doctors’ offices offer transportation assistance or have evening and weekend hours to accommodate seniors’ schedules. By seeing our doctor regularly, we can stay healthy and catch any potential problems early on.
